What Is Contouring Sketch?
Contouring sketch refers to the strategic application of makeup to create optical shadows and highlights on the skin, simulating light and form. Unlike traditional makeup, contouring follows the natural lines of the face — jawline, cheekbones, temples, and nose — to mimic shadows cast by natural lighting. The result? A polished, sculpted look that adds depth, dimension, and elegance.
While contouring often uses products like powder or cream contour palettes, the sketch-like approach emphasizes clean, defined edges using tools such as contour brushes, pencils, or pencils with pencil-like precision. This technique thrives on precision and balance, making it both a technical skill and an artistic expression.

Essential Tools & Products for Perfect Contouring Sketch
Before diving into technique, arm yourself with the right tools:
- Contour brush: Angled apply precision; ideal for smooth transitions.
- Contour pencil or powder: Use cream or powder formulations; pencil gradation allows fine detail.
- Setting powder or setting spray: To blend edges and lock in your look.
- Mind the eyes and brows: Contour around the eyes subtly for definition without overpowering.
- Tongs or small spoons: For precise product application.
Pro tip: Neutral tones (browns, taupes) work best for natural sculpting, while cooler shades sculpt deeper shadows. Always blend thoroughly to avoid harsh lines.
